Are there deadlines for
applying?
There are no specific deadlines. The Foundation's financial year runs from
1st June to 31st May and the Trustees hold regular meetings within that
period. The Foundation staff can advise you about the timescale for submitting
an application and it being considered by the Trustees. Please contact us
on 01737 228000.
We are not yet a charity but are applying for charitable status – can we still apply?
No, we cannot accept an application from your organisation until you have received your charity registration from the Charity Commission.
Is there a maximum or minimum amount
that charities can request?
No, each grant request is reviewed on its own merits.
What is the situation for branches of national charities?
If you have your own charity registration number, constitution and board of trustees, you may apply in your own right. We do not require the endorsement of your headquarters organisation.
If you are part of a larger or a national charity, with the same charity number, and legally governed by the same board of trustees, we require the endorsement of your larger/national charity.
Can we apply to more than one grants programme?
No, you may only apply to one of the programmes at any time.
Do you give feedback on unsuccessful applications?
If your application is not successful, we will write to you and give you feedback as required. The main reason for not funding projects is that we receive many more applications than we can support and we inevitably have to disappoint many of the charities that apply to us.
What is your policy on reapplications?
Charities awarded a grant by the Foundation may not make another application for three years, from the date of the final grant payment.
Charities whose applications are not successful may make another application after one year, from the date of the previous rejection.
